Transaction 60d34ce567d87dadc421e8a53f2c834b11840b91fe9879f24e0fdb89cdaef97d
1 Input
1 Output
-
60d34ce567d87dadc421e8a53f2c834b11840b91fe9879f24e0fdb89cdaef97d:0
- value
- 1451913674
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7aa5ce90b8b3e3e25102ebe52ba1a86383d2f1ff OP_EQUAL
- address
- 3CsWzQrjDU93jZRp2JPg9WUJcBaE5svvuw